Cellular Effects



The cellular results of cold laser treatment materialize via raised energy manufacturing and enhanced cellular repair systems. When the cold laser light penetrates the skin and gets to the targeted cells, it stimulates the mitochondria, the powerhouse of the cell, to produce even more adenosine triphosphate (ATP).

This increase in ATP offers cells with the power they need to accomplish numerous features, such as repairing damage and decreasing inflammation.

In addition, cold laser treatment activates a waterfall of biochemical reactions within the cells that promote healing and regrowth. By improving mobile fixing devices, the therapy accelerates cells healing and reduces recovery time from injuries or certain problems.


This procedure likewise aids to raise blood circulation to the cured area, bringing in even more oxygen and nutrients essential for mobile repair.
